Output 81d59e35e7c8c2a1a59d664abe56b31cd991d17fd376bf045cd9c70cff02906e:23

value
623623
script pubkey
OP_0 OP_PUSHBYTES_20 f1e23b38fe11376ec20f669e2eba0e09aa60c68b
address
bc1q783rkw87zymkass0v60zawswpx4xp35talfj7p
transaction
81d59e35e7c8c2a1a59d664abe56b31cd991d17fd376bf045cd9c70cff02906e
spent
true